- The distance between Bucharest, Romania and Turgay, Kazakhstan is approximately 2,860 km or 1,777 mi.
- To reach Bucharest in this distance one would set out from Turgay bearing 273° or W and follow the great circles arc to approach Bucharest bearing 245.1° or WSW .
- Bucharest has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Turgay has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k).
- Bucharest is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ome whereas Turgay is in or near the cool temperate desert scrub biome.
- The average annual temperature is 6.4 °C (11.4°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 16.6 °C (29.9°F) less in Bucharest.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 418 mm (16.5 in) more which is equivalent to 418 l/m² (10.26 US gal/ft²) or 4,180,000 l/ha (446,870 US gal/ac) more. About 3 1/3 as much.
- There are 263 fewer hours of sunlight per year in Bucharest. In whichever way circa 0h 43' less per day or about 8/9 as many.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 5.1° higher in Bucharest than in Turgay.
- Relative humidity levels are 6.1%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 7.7°C (13.9°F) higher.
